Ad hoc analysis

Here you will find links to statistical analyses undertaken by HSE statisticians in support of policy and operational work which are not part of our regular National Statistics release. The findings from these analyses may have been used in briefings, consultations or press and ministerial statements.

Statistical information which is judged to be of wider public interest and has been released under the Freedom of Information Act is published under FOI releases below:
